On the morning of September 1, 1939, the German battleship Schleswig-Holstein fired on the Polish garrison stationed at the Westerplatte peninsula. Over the next seven days, fewer than 200 soldiers fought against the Nazi onslaught. Amidst the bloodshed, two Polish commanders struggled with the decision to keep fighting or surrender against the overwhelming odds. 1 hr. 58 min.
